Send us Fan MailEmanuel Galimidi is the founder of Galimidi Law, a Florida-based Personal Injury and Wrongful Death law firm but his story is anything but conventional. Before founding Galimidi Law, Emanuel was a shareholder at one of the most successful and fastest-growing defense firms in the United States, with offices in Miami, New York, and Los Angeles  where he rose through the ranks to become head of the Product Liability Practice Group. He spent nearly two decades representing multinational corporations  and then made the bold decision to flip the script entirely. Galimidi Law was founded on the belief that everyone deserves access to the same level of representation that insurance companies and large corporations enjoy  bringing that same elite expertise to the injured and their families. Emanuel believes in the power of relationships, staying risk-aware without being risk-averse, and never being afraid to make the bold call when it matters. Today, he's joining us to talk about what real leadership looks like in a legal world being reshaped by AI  and trust me, he's got some things to say. Connect with Emmanuel: @galimidi_law Visit Site: www.galimidilaw.com Welcome to Let’s Talk Paralegal—where the legal industry gets real.
